Travis CI...

I noticed on a pull request (and on my fork) that Travis CI doesn't seem
very reliable. I get a fail on at least one of the 6 builds almost every
time, and even if I change nothing, it seems to succeed/fail on another of
the 6 each time, unrelated to my code...

Has anyone else seen this?

Re: Travis CI...

Posted by Bolke de Bruin <bd...@gmail.com>.
The update that I am doing on moving to Travis to Trusty seems to make builds more stable. However, as tests currently do not pass as Travis uses MySQL 5.6 we have an issue to solve there that I am discussing with Arthur. Basically do we change the schema for mysql to support microseconds or do we adjust airflow. Arthur is in favor of adjusting airflow (make datetime.now() not return microseconds) and slight more in favor of adjusting the schema.
